Description

A kind of manual fine grinder
Technical field
The utility model relates to food processing machinery technical field, is specially one and dry fruit, meat, veterinary antibiotics can be ground to form particle, is applicable to the grinder of infant and the bad feed of the elderly's age of a draught animal.
Background technology
The grinder that sell in the market and family is using, can realize grinding to form particle, instant edible to dry fruit, meat, veterinary antibiotics etc., its process velocity is fast, effect is good, thus deeply by the favor of people.But traditional grinder still has dismounting inconvenience and life-span short defect cut by mill, requires further improvement.

detailed description of the invention:
Be described further below with reference to the technique effect of accompanying drawing to design of the present utility model, concrete structure and generation, to understand the purpose of this utility model, characteristic sum effect fully.
Consult shown in Fig. 1 ~ 4, the utility model is about a kind of manual fine grinder, this grinder upright type of design, there is grinding container 1, container upper cover 2, spiral feeding axis 3, in figure, container upper cover 2 passes through rotatable interface Moveable assembled in the upper port of grinding container 1, conveniently location and installation uses, preferably, be provided with loose joint portion 11 bottom grinding container 1, this loose joint portion 11 connects a sucker base 9, utilizes sucker base 9 to be fixed in respective mesa, can realize grinding container 1 being positioned on sucker base 9, so that attrition process.Spiral feeding axis 3 is sheathed in the feed cylinder 4 that container upper cover 2 is arranged, and the upper nose of spiral feeding axis 3 is connected with handle 32, facilitates hand processing.The outer section that feed cylinder 4 protrudes container upper cover 2 is provided with charging aperture 43, facilitates charging; Spiral feeding axis 3 utilizes the rotation screw thread on it, realizes rotating feeding, and on the feeding termination of spiral feeding axis 3, group is provided with grinding cutter head 5, and grinding cutter head 5 is followed spiral feeding axis 3 and rotated, and uses light; In the present embodiment, grinding cutter head 5 is designed to windmill moulding, increases mill point of contact.Grinding cutter head 5 coordinates certain cutterhead 6 to grind, and 6 groups, stationary knife dish is located at the end of feed cylinder 4, and stationary knife dish 6 is perpendicular with spiral feeding axis 3, stationary knife dish 6 has pore 61 and is communicated with grinding container 1.During work, grinding cutter head 5 System of Rotating about Fixed Axis on 6, stationary knife dish, realize grinding cutter head 5 and stationary knife dish 6 attrition process, the particle that pore 61 on stationary knife dish 6 not only conveniently processes is fallen in grinding container 1, also increase friction effect, make that grinding rate is faster, effect is better, promote working (machining) efficiency and quality.In the present embodiment, in order to usability and the grinding effect of further improving product, the feeding termination of spiral feeding axis 3 is provided with the alignment pin 31 of evagination, this alignment pin 31 is successively through the mesopore grinding cutter head 5 and stationary knife dish 6, coaxial installation, grinding cutter head 5 and stationary knife dish 6 coordinate tightr, and grinding gap is stablized.
Shown in Fig. 1 ~ 4, in the present embodiment, the periphery of described grinding cutter head 5 is provided with annular grinding ring 7, and annular grinding ring 7 adopts stainless steel to make together with stationary knife dish 6, wear-resisting, non-corrosive.Annular grinding ring 7 inner circumferential is provided with roll flute 71, and roll flute 71 coordinates grinding cutter head 5 mill to cut, and long service life, promotes grinding rate.Annular grinding ring 7 and 6 subsides of stationary knife dish of the present embodiment are combined in the end of feed cylinder 4, the termination of feed cylinder 4 is provided with fool proof location division 45, annular grinding ring 7 and the periphery of stationary knife dish 6 are respectively equipped with chucking lug 72 and 62, conveniently locate assembling, there is foolproof function, make annular grinding ring 7 paste tightr with 6, stationary knife dish.Feed cylinder 4 be movable set in the through hole 21 of container upper cover 2, feed cylinder 4 has edge clipping 41 and be connected on through hole 21 outboard end, and feed cylinder 4 inner termination is provided with external screw thread 42, external screw thread 42 to connect in one logical interior tooth end cap 8; Interior tooth end cap 8 is locked feed cylinder 4 and is connected with container upper cover 2, annular grinding ring 7 and stationary knife dish 6 is fixed on the end of feed cylinder 4 simultaneously, and the pore 61 on stationary knife dish 6 is communicated with grinding container 1 by the middle through hole of interior tooth end cap 8.This structure is simple, easy accessibility, quick, is connected closely, the usability of improving product between parts.
Shown in Fig. 1 ~ 4, in the present embodiment, in order to further facilitate use, the outer section that described feed cylinder 4 protrudes container upper cover 2 is provided with charging box 44, and charging box 44 is communicated with charging aperture 43, and charging aperture 43 is opened on feed cylinder 4 sidewall, and side direction charging, working regularity is good.Charging box 44 is around the design of feed cylinder 4 periphery, and be designed to groove 441 at the position be communicated with charging aperture 43, in groove 441, Moveable assembled has guide skewback 442.During use, can load onto guide skewback 442, give guide and enter charging aperture 43, also can unload guide skewback 442, enter charging aperture 43 by the artificial pusher of groove 441, concrete use can be determined according to actual conditions; For convenience of pusher, also pusher 46 can be equipped with.The mesopore upper end of the suit spiral feeding axis 3 of feed cylinder 4 is provided with metal gasket 47, and metal gasket 47 pastes the corresponding end-faces of support top spiral feeding axis 3, is integrated between metal gasket 47 and feed cylinder 4 by casting.Metal gasket 47 strengthens the structural of feed cylinder 4, and crush resistance is stronger, explosion-proof, increases the service life, and metal gasket 47 coordinates spiral feeding axis 3 to rotate support top simultaneously, reduces temperature rise, is beneficial to screw rod and rotates processing.
